Key Factors Influencing Perishable Supplies Preservation in Combat
Several factors significantly influence the preservation of perishable supplies in combat environments. Temperature control remains paramount, as fluctuations can accelerate spoilage, especially for items like medical supplies and food that require refrigeration or consistent cooling. Moisture management is equally critical, since excess humidity can promote microbial growth and compromise the integrity of perishable items.
Additionally, security concerns impact preservation efforts. Protecting supplies from theft or tampering often dictates storage and transportation methods, which can influence temperature stability. Logistical factors, including transportation speed and routing, also play vital roles; rapid delivery minimizes shelf-life loss and spoilage risks. Lastly, environmental conditions such as humidity, dust, and exposure to elements can compromise storage conditions, making protective measures crucial in combat zones where infrastructure is limited. Awareness and mitigation of these key factors are essential for effective perishable supplies handling in combat situations.

Use of Insulated Containers and Packaging Materials
The use of insulated containers and packaging materials is vital for maintaining the quality of perishable supplies in combat situations. These materials help regulate temperature and prevent spoilage during transportation and storage.
Insulated containers, such as thermo-shipping boxes and refrigerated units, provide a controlled environment that minimizes temperature fluctuations. They are often equipped with foam or reflective linings to enhance thermal insulation.
Packaging materials include insulated gel packs, phase-change materials, and vacuum-sealed bags, which sustain consistent temperatures over extended periods. The selection of appropriate materials depends on the type of perishable item and the expected transit duration.
Key strategies involve:
- Using durable, thermally efficient insulative packaging
- Incorporating advanced cooling elements for prolonged preservation
- Ensuring secure sealing to prevent contamination or temperature leaks
These measures significantly contribute to the effective handling of perishable supplies in combat zones, ensuring supply integrity and operational readiness.

Security Measures for Protecting Perishable Items
Security measures for protecting perishable supplies in combat are vital to prevent theft, tampering, and spoilage. Implementing strict access controls ensures only authorized personnel handle sensitive items, reducing security breaches.
Surveillance systems, such as cameras and alarm setups, serve to monitor storage areas continuously, deterring potential threats. Regular patrols and security personnel inspections add an additional layer of protection in volatile environments.
Secure storage facilities with reinforced fencing and lockable containers further safeguard perishable supplies. These measures minimize the risk of sabotage and unauthorized access, which could compromise supply integrity.
Additionally, tracking technologies like RFID and GPS enable real-time monitoring of perishable items during transport and storage. These innovations help promptly identify security issues, allowing swift action to prevent spoilage or theft.

Technological Innovations Supporting Handling of Perishable Supplies
Advancements in technology have significantly enhanced the handling of perishable supplies in combat scenarios. Modern solutions include temperature monitoring devices, automated tracking systems, and mobile refrigeration units, which collectively ensure supply integrity during transport and storage.
- Smart sensors can continuously record temperature and humidity levels, providing real-time data to supply personnel. This enables immediate response to any deviations that could compromise perishable items.
- RFID and GPS technologies facilitate precise inventory management and supply chain visibility, minimizing delays and spoilage risks.
- Portable refrigeration units equipped with digital controls maintain optimal conditions in variable environments, offering flexibility in combat zones.
These technological innovations not only improve preservation but also streamline logistics operations, ensuring rapid and secure delivery of perishable supplies in challenging conditions, ultimately supporting operational readiness.
